#b0f4b5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b0f4b5 is composed of 69% red, 95.7% green and 71%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 27.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 25.8% yellow and 4.3% black. It has a hue angle of 124.4 degrees, a saturation of 75.6% and a lightness of 82.4%. #b0f4b5 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#61e96b. Closest websafe color is: #99ffcc.

#b0f4b5 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b0f4b5 has RGB values of R:176, G:244, B:181 and CMYK values of C:0.28, M:0, Y:0.26,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 11596981.
